Connectome: How the brain’s wiring makes us who we are

Connectome: How the brain’s wiring makes us who we are

Thursday 14 June, 13:00

Rising star in the field of neuroscience Sebastian Seung argues that our identity lies not in our genes but in the connections between our brain cells – and he describes the monumental task of mapping these “connectomes”, neuron by neuron, synapse by synapse.

How Much Is Enough?

How Much Is Enough?

Thursday 21 June, 13:00

Robert and Edward Skidelsky argue that wealth is not an end in itself but a means to the achievement and maintenance of a 'good life', and that our economy should be organised to reflect this fact.
